Translation — Tafsir
Key Words and Their Meanings:
- Al-Rajfah (الرَّجْفَةُ): The severe earthquake or violent tremor that shakes the earth violently.
- Jāthimīn (جَاثِمِينَ): Those who have fallen dead, collapsed on their knees, faces pressed to the ground, motionless and lifeless.
Explanation of the Verse:
After Prophet Shu'ayb (peace be upon him) delivered his message with clarity and sincerity, calling his people to worship Allah alone and to abandon their fraudulent practices in trade and dealings, his people—the inhabitants of Madyan—rejected him and persisted in their denial. They did not merely refuse his call; they belied him outright, treating his warnings as empty words.
So Allah's punishment descended upon them: a mighty earthquake seized them, shaking the very ground beneath their feet. The earth trembled violently, and in an instant, their homes became their graves. By morning, they lay dead in their own dwellings, fallen on their knees, lifeless bodies pressed to the dust—a horrific scene of utter destruction and humiliation. No one survived to tell the tale, and their wealth, power, and numbers availed them nothing against the decree of their Lord.
A Call to Reflection and Faith:
This verse stands as a timeless reminder that no power, wealth, or social standing can shield anyone from the consequence of rejecting the truth. The people of Madyan were not weak or ignorant; they were a thriving community with established systems of trade and commerce. Yet, when they chose arrogance over humility and denial over faith, their worldly strength turned to dust in a single moment.
